Dwayne Bravo will be missed , says Trinbago Knight Riders manager Colin Borde

Dwayne Bravo - DWAYNE BRAVO will not be appearing for the Trinbago Knight Riders in this year s edition of the Caribbean Premier League (CPL) T20 tournament. On Friday, the former TKR captain, who led the TT franchise to victory in 2015, 2017 and 2018, revealed that at his own request, he had been traded to the St Kitts and Nevis Patriots (SKNP) for the forthcoming season. Bravo’s request to change teams was agreed on by TKR management. In return, SKNP traded wicketkeeper/batsman Denesh Ramdin to TKR. Ramdin is also a former TKR player, who represented the franchise from 2016-2019. Bravo had contributed to the TKR, four-time winners. since the inception of the CPL in 2013.

TKR trade DJ Bravo to St Kitts & Nevis Patriots

TKR trade DJ Bravo to St Kitts & Nevis Patriots Dwayne Bravo has left the Trinbago Knight Riders. PHOTO COURTESY CPL T20 - Trinbago Knight Riders (TKR) has agreed to trade former captain Dwayne Bravo to the St Kitts and Nevis Patriots for the 2021 Caribbean Premier League. In return, the four-time champions will receive veteran wicketkeeper/batsman Denesh Ramdin from the Patriots. A statement issued by TT franchise, on Friday, said Bravo, who had been with the team since CPL inception in 2013, made the switch in search of a new challenge. Bravo said, “At this stage in my career, I needed a new challenge, which is to work with the young talent for the benefit for Cricket West Indies.
